Content Structure of the Textbook
The BC Science 8 Textbook is organized into four main units: Cells and Systems, Optics and Light, Fluids and Dynamics, and Water Systems on Earth, providing a comprehensive learning journey for students.
3.1 Unit 1: Cells and Systems
Unit 1 explores the fundamental biology of cells and systems, introducing concepts such as cell structure, functions, and the human body’s systems. It emphasizes how cells perform life processes and maintain health, connecting microscopic biology to larger bodily functions. Interactive diagrams and activities help students visualize cellular mechanisms and understand the interconnectedness of biological systems, fostering a strong foundation in life sciences.
3.2 Unit 2: Optics and Light
Unit 2 delves into the behavior of light, exploring concepts such as reflection, refraction, and optical instruments. Students learn how light interacts with mirrors and lenses, forming images. The unit includes detailed diagrams and activities, like “Using Mirrors to Form Images,” to engage learners. Topics range from the ray model of light to real-world applications, helping students understand the science behind vision and technology. Interactive elements in the PDF enhance comprehension of optical phenomena.
3.3 Unit 3: Fluids and Dynamics
Unit 3 explores the properties and behavior of fluids, including pressure, buoyancy, and fluid dynamics. Students learn about the forces acting on fluids and their applications in real-world scenarios. Concepts such as Pascal’s principle and Bernoulli’s principle are introduced to explain fluid behavior. Interactive activities and diagrams in the PDF help visualize these principles, making complex ideas accessible. This unit bridges theoretical knowledge with practical examples, fostering a deeper understanding of fluid mechanics and their everyday applications.
3.4 Unit 4: Water Systems on Earth
Unit 4 delves into Earth’s water systems, covering the water cycle, oceans, and freshwater sources. Students explore how water shapes the planet and sustains life. Topics include ocean currents, water conservation, and the impact of human activities on water systems. The PDF version incorporates visuals and real-world examples, helping students understand the interconnectedness of water systems and their role in maintaining Earth’s ecosystems. This unit emphasizes environmental stewardship and the importance of responsible water management.
